Cassiterite concentrate is the primary feedstock for tin production and is graded by tin assay, impurity levels and moisture. Industry practice classifies a “premium” grade when tin content exceeds 55 % and impurity levels remain below 5 % iron equivalents, which aligns with the supplier’s range. Typical moisture content for dried concentrate is below 1 % to avoid processing issues, a standard the supplier aims to achieve. The product conforms to common international testing methods such as X‑ray fluorescence (XRF) for assay verification.

Before placing an order, verify the tin assay, impurity profile and moisture content against the specifications provided. Request a recent assay certificate, preferably based on XRF, and confirm that the supplier can supply a material safety data sheet (MSDS) for the concentrate. Ensure that any claimed ISO or SGS certifications are current and correspond to the specific batch you intend to purchase.
Logistics for Nigerian tin ore typically involve loading the bulk concentrate at the Port of Lagos or Port Harcourt, with shipping terms negotiable between FOB and CIF. Discuss expected lead‑time, which can vary with seasonal mining output, and clarify the incoterms that will apply to your transaction. Payment methods such as L/C or T/T should be agreed in advance, together with any bank guarantees required by the supplier.
Arrange for an independent third‑party inspection at the loading port to verify grade, weight and packaging integrity. Inspection agencies can perform on‑site sampling for tin content and impurity analysis, providing a report that can be used for quality assurance. Collect all relevant documentation, including the assay certificate, MSDS and any export licences, before the goods are dispatched to ensure smooth customs clearance at the destination.
